FHLBank Boston Welcomes New 2025 Board Members
FHLBank Boston is pleased to announce its newly elected board members for 2025.
More About the Board of Directors:
FHLBank Boston conducted an election to fill one member directorship in Rhode Island and two independent directorships, each with a four-year term commencing on January 1, 2025.
- Gregg C. Tumeinski, executive vice president and chief financial officer of The Beacon Mutual Insurance Company in Warwick, Rhode Island, was elected a member director representing Rhode Island.
- Thomas J. Curry, a retired law partner and regulator in Osterville, Massachusetts, was reelected as a public interest independent director.
- Antoinette C. Lazarus, regulatory, compliance, and risk executive in Hartford, Connecticut, was reelected as an independent director.
FHLBank Boston's board of directors is comprised of professionals with experience in financial services, housing and community development, real estate, risk management, and the law. The board includes member and independent directors from the six New England states who are elected by members to serve four-year terms. The entire board list is available here.
